#135b04 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#135b04 is composed of 7.5% red, 35.7% green and 1.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 79.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 95.6% yellow and 64.3% black. It has a hue angle of 109.7 degrees, a saturation of 91.6% and a lightness of 18.6%. #135b04 color hex could be obtained by blending #26b608 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006600.

Shades and Tints of #135b04
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#031001 is the darkest color, while #fdfffc is the lightest one.

Tones of #135b04
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#2d332c is the less saturated color, while #115f00 is the most saturated one.
